{"id":424852,"date":"2025-02-17T13:04:34","date_gmt":"2025-02-17T13:04:34","guid":{"rendered":"https:\/\/www.ninjaone.com\/?post_type=content_hub&#038;p=424852"},"modified":"2025-02-17T14:18:33","modified_gmt":"2025-02-17T14:18:33","slug":"odata-que-es","status":"publish","type":"content_hub","link":"https:\/\/www.ninjaone.com\/es\/it-hub\/it-service-management\/odata-que-es\/","title":{"rendered":"\u00bfQu\u00e9 es OData? Explicaci\u00f3n del Protocolo de Datos Abiertos"},"content":{"rendered":"<p><span style=\"font-weight: 400;\">Los datos son esenciales en el sector de las TI: motivan decisiones, configuran estrategias e impulsan muchas de las tecnolog\u00edas que utilizamos a diario. Pero para aprovechar plenamente el poder de los datos, \u00e9stos deben ser accesibles y manipulables. Ah\u00ed es donde <\/span><b>OData<\/b><span style=\"font-weight: 400;\">, el Protocolo de Datos Abiertos, resulta \u00fatil.<\/span><\/p>\n<h2>\u00bfQu\u00e9 es OData?<\/h2>\n<p><span style=\"font-weight: 400;\">Tambi\u00e9n conocido como Protocolo de Dato Abiertos, es un est\u00e1ndar abierto que define un conjunto de buenas pr\u00e1cticas para crear y consumir <\/span><a href=\"https:\/\/www.ninjaone.com\/blog\/api-endpoint-definition-and-best-practices\/\"><span style=\"font-weight: 400;\">API <\/span><\/a><span style=\"font-weight: 400;\">RESTful. Fue iniciado por Microsoft en 2007 y posteriormente traspasado a la Organizaci\u00f3n para el Avance de los Est\u00e1ndares de Informaci\u00f3n Estructurada (OASIS) en 2012.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">El est\u00e1ndar OData permite la creaci\u00f3n de servicios de datos basados en HTTP, que permiten publicar y editar recursos, identificados mediante URL y definidos en un modelo de datos, por parte de clientes web mediante simples mensajes HTTP. En esencia, es un protocolo estandarizado para crear y consumir API de datos.<\/span><\/p>\n<h2>Objetivo<\/h2>\n<p><span style=\"font-weight: 400;\">El objetivo principal de OData es proporcionar un protocolo claro, estandarizado y f\u00e1cil de usar que permita compartir datos entre aplicaciones, servicios y almacenes. Su objetivo es simplificar el proceso de intercambio de datos, haci\u00e9ndolo m\u00e1s eficiente y f\u00e1cil de usar.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">OData permite solicitar y escribir datos en recursos, utilizando protocolos web conocidos como GET, POST, PUT, DELETE, PATCH. Esto significa que los desarrolladores pueden utilizar OData para exponer y manejar datos a trav\u00e9s de la Web, u otras redes, desde una gran variedad de aplicaciones, servicios y almacenes. Proporciona una forma uniforme de exponer, estructurar y manipular datos con API RESTful.<\/span><\/p>\n<h2>\u00bfC\u00f3mo funciona?<\/h2>\n<p><span style=\"font-weight: 400;\">OData funciona ampliando el protocolo HTTP existente, lo que permite la interacci\u00f3n de datos utilizando los m\u00e9todos est\u00e1ndar mencionados anteriormente. Un servicio OData t\u00edpico incluye un Documento de Servicio, un Documento de Metadatos de Servicio, Colecciones de Recursos y Operaciones de Servicio.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">El Documento de Servicio es una representaci\u00f3n simple de todas las colecciones de datos disponibles a las que se puede acceder. El documento de metadatos de servicio establece la estructura de datos, incluidos los tipos de entidad, las propiedades, las relaciones, etc.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">Las colecciones de recursos son conjuntos de recursos que pueden abordarse individualmente. Suelen agruparse por tipo de entidad. Las Operaciones de Servicio son esencialmente funciones que pueden ser llamadas en el punto final del servicio, permitiendo la l\u00f3gica del lado del servidor.<\/span><\/p>\n<p><span style=\"font-weight: 400;\">Cuando un cliente desea interactuar con los datos, env\u00eda una petici\u00f3n HTTP al punto final del servicio OData. A continuaci\u00f3n, el servidor procesa la solicitud, realiza las operaciones necesarias y devuelve una respuesta HTTP, normalmente en forma de documento Atom o JSON.<\/span><\/p>\n<h2>Conclusi\u00f3n<\/h2>\n<p><span style=\"font-weight: 400;\">OData es un potente protocolo que simplifica el proceso de trabajar con datos a trav\u00e9s de Internet. Proporciona un m\u00e9todo estandarizado para exponer, estructurar y manipular datos, lo que la convierte en una herramienta esencial tanto para desarrolladores como para profesionales de TI. Si entiendes e implementas este protocolo, estar\u00e1s dando un gran paso hacia la gesti\u00f3n y utilizaci\u00f3n eficientes de los datos.<\/span><\/p>\n","protected":false},"author":89,"featured_media":0,"parent":0,"template":"","meta":{"_acf_changed":false,"_relevanssi_hide_post":"","_relevanssi_hide_content":"","_relevanssi_pin_for_all":"","_relevanssi_pin_keywords":"","_relevanssi_unpin_keywords":"","_relevanssi_related_keywords":"","_relevanssi_related_include_ids":"","_relevanssi_related_exclude_ids":"","_relevanssi_related_no_append":"","_relevanssi_related_not_related":"","_relevanssi_related_posts":"","_relevanssi_noindex_reason":"","_lmt_disableupdate":"no","_lmt_disable":""},"hub_categories":[4190],"class_list":["post-424852","content_hub","type-content_hub","status-publish","hentry","content_hub_category-it-service-management"],"acf":[],"_links":{"self":[{"href":"https:\/\/www.ninjaone.com\/es\/wp-json\/wp\/v2\/content_hub\/424852","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.ninjaone.com\/es\/wp-json\/wp\/v2\/content_hub"}],"about":[{"href":"https:\/\/www.ninjaone.com\/es\/wp-json\/wp\/v2\/types\/content_hub"}],"author":[{"embeddable":true,"href":"https:\/\/www.ninjaone.com\/es\/wp-json\/wp\/v2\/users\/89"}],"wp:attachment":[{"href":"https:\/\/www.ninjaone.com\/es\/wp-json\/wp\/v2\/media?parent=424852"}],"wp:term":[{"taxonomy":"content_hub_category","embeddable":true,"href":"https:\/\/www.ninjaone.com\/es\/wp-json\/wp\/v2\/hub_categories?post=424852"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}